Journal of Materials and Engineering examines new research and development at the materials and engineering. It provides a common forum for both frontline practicioners as well as pioneering academic research.
The journal's multidisciplinary approach draws from such fields as Biomaterials; Ceramic Science and Engineering; Characterization and Microscopy; Computational Materials Science and Engineering; Corrosion; Electronic, Photonic, and Magnetic Materials; Energy Materials; Mechanical Properties of Materials; Metallic Materials; Polymers; Processing and Manufacturing; Sensor Materials and Technologies; Tribology; Welding Engineering; General Materials; Other...
Both the Editorial Advisory Group and the Editorial Board feature outstanding individuals from academia and industry, ensuring that all the multiple frontiers are covered.
